Background technique
Ecologic planting refers on unit area soil, according to the growth of different crops law of development, by between agricultural, set etc. Plantation and modern production technology effective integration, natural resources, living resources are made full use of, and are obtaining higher yield and economy Circulation of the substance in the ecosystem is promoted while benefit or is used repeatedly, and the ecologic food chain of health is formed.This Patent is that a kind of ecological circulation of hayashishita medicine bacterium utilizes cropping pattern.
Rhizoma Gastrodiae is the stem tuber of orchid Gastrodia elata Bl., for traditional rare Chinese medicine, is clinically used for treatment head Swoon dizzy, extremity numbness, child convulsion etc. card.Because Rhizoma Gastrodiae is septic herbaceous plant, unrooted is free of photosynthetic pigments, no without leaf The nutrients such as inorganic salts can be absorbed directly from soil, the dip dyeing that the seed sprouting stage needs Germination Strain could germinate, grow Development must supply nutrition by halimasch.Therefore, the planting environment of Rhizoma Gastrodiae needs while meeting halimasch, Germination Strain and Rhizoma Gastrodiae Growth conditions;Umbellate pore furgus is the sclerotium of On Polyporaceae umbellate pore furgus Polyporus umbellatus (Pers.) Friesl, nature and flavor It is sweet light flat, it is the conventional Chinese medicine of clearing damp and promoting diuresis.Artificial growth umbellate pore furgus needs could get bumper crops for 3~4 years;Winter sweet-smelling grass is that Phallaceae Phallus is white The fructification of Phallus Phallus inpudicus L.ex.Pers. fungi is a kind of Rare edible fungus, delicious flavour, mouthfeel pine It is crisp, there is high nutritive value.
In production, planting rhizoma gastrodiae need to cut down tree production bacterium material, and the bacterium material not run out of after plantation can no longer be used to Rhizoma Gastrodiae Production.Soil after Rhizoma Gastrodiae plantation could need to plant again after 5 years, and otherwise Rhizoma Gastrodiae continuous cropping will appear character degeneration.This patent is logical Cross arrangement summarize practice what they preach cultivation experience and plantation practice, according to Rhizoma Gastrodiae, umbellate pore furgus, winter sweet-smelling grass growth-development law, using biography Between system agricultural, the planting patterns such as set combined with modern agriculture science and technology, through same cave interplanting umbellate pore furgus, and within interval Winter sweet-smelling grass is planted, can both improve the continuous cropping obstacle of planting rhizoma gastrodiae, also make full use of bacterium material, makes kind of the fast quick-recovery of ground ecology, solves The yield decline that occurs after continuous planting rhizoma gastrodiae, quality deterioration, improve the utilization rate in soil, bacterium material are made to obtain recycling Rate achievees the purpose that restore kind of a ground ecological environment.
Summary of the invention
It is an object of the present invention to realizing the ecologic planting of Rhizoma Gastrodiae, umbellate pore furgus, winter sweet-smelling grass, accelerate kind ground after planting rhizoma gastrodiae raw The recovery of state.
Another object of the present invention is that sufficiently using Gastrodia realizing there is output every year, bacterium material follows with bacterium material Ring utilizes.Applicant sets up Research Team, carries out the plantation practiced what they preach for many years practice, by cultivating experience to Rhizoma Gastrodiae, umbellate pore furgus And the growth characteristics of winter sweet-smelling grass are arranged and are summarized, the method for finally having verified ecologic planting Rhizoma Gastrodiae, umbellate pore furgus, winter sweet-smelling grass is specially same Circulation interplanting Rhizoma Gastrodiae, umbellate pore furgus, kind winter sweet-smelling grass in bacterium bed.It is characterized in that, planting rhizoma gastrodiae, umbellate pore furgus are recycled in same bacterium bed, Umbellate pore furgus, upper layer planting rhizoma gastrodiae are planted by middle lower layer.Existing research shows, Rhizoma Gastrodiae can be shared with umbellate pore furgus halimasch (a kind of Rhizoma Gastrodiae with The cultural method of umbellate pore furgus interplanting, patent of invention, publication No.:CN102047806), and the production cycle of the two it is inconsistent, umbellate pore furgus is raw The production period is long, and Rhizoma Gastrodiae harvests 1~2 year prior to umbellate pore furgus, and umbellate pore furgus is relative to Rhizoma Gastrodiae humidity.Using upper layer planting rhizoma gastrodiae, lower layer The mode of umbellate pore furgus is planted, Rhizoma Gastrodiae harvests after generally planting 2~3 years, and umbellate pore furgus need to be planted 3~4 years and could get bumper crops, and harvests upper layer day The growth of lower layer umbellate pore furgus is not influenced when numb, the bacterium material not run out of after collecting tuber of elevated gastrodia can supply umbellate pore furgus growth, be conducive to umbellate pore furgus High yield is obtained, while also promoting the resolution of bacterium material.Applicant is shown consumed by winter sweet-smelling grass and halimasch growth by test of many times Nutritional ingredient is different, and after harvesting umbellate pore furgus, kind winter sweet-smelling grass can further make full use of bacterium material, absorb in the bacterium material never run out of Nutritional ingredient completes the growth of fructification.Winter sweet-smelling grass adaptability is stronger, and competitiveness is strong, is not required to excessive farming operations and field Management, the production cycle is fast, primary to plant, and can continuously harvest for 2 seasons, and bacterium material clears up completion substantially after two seasons, realizes the circulation of bacterium material It utilizes.Winter sweet-smelling grass may also suppress spoilage organisms growth, other miscellaneous bacterias are as competitiveness is low and dead, and winter sweet-smelling grass is aerobic, plantation When do not need earthing, accelerate the air circulation inside and outside bacterium bed, promote kind of a recovery for ground ecology.Therefore, after planting winter sweet-smelling grass, bacterium bed warp Simple removal of impurities disinfection treatment is crossed, i.e., recyclable Rhizoma Gastrodiae interplants the production model of umbellate pore furgus, kind winter sweet-smelling grass, realizes ecologic planting.
The preferably a kind of method of ecologic planting Rhizoma Gastrodiae, umbellate pore furgus, winter sweet-smelling grass, which is characterized in that the broken blade of the broad leaf tree used Size is 1~4cm2, compared with not processed blade, effectively raise the rate of vaccination of strain.
Umbellate pore furgus is planted by preferred lower layer, which is characterized in that after fixed bacterium bed, is poured and is spilt with 2%~5% limewash;About 48 After hour, the broken blade of broad leaf tree for spreading 1~3mm of a layer thickness is rebasing, and the new bacterium material of bulk is replaced with the bacterium material of inoculation halimasch It puts, is about spaced 2cm between bacterium material;The bacterium material for being inoculated with halimasch is chopped to fish scale mouth every 10~15cm, is put at fish scale mouth The umbellate pore furgus strain and Armillaria mellea of one piece of 2cm square are put, gap is tamped with the new bacterium material of fritter or fine earth, cladding thickness about 4cm Fine earth;The new bacterium material of 1 layer of bulk of laid parallel, bacterium material interval about 2cm, puts the Armillaria mellea of 2cm square, bacterium in interval Kind is spaced 10~15cm, is tamped between gap with the new bacterium material of fritter or fine earth, broadcasts sowing the broken blade of a layer thickness 1~3mm broad leaf tree, cover Lid 8~10cm of thickness fine earth is to get numb bed.The planting rhizoma gastrodiae on numb bed, specially:Numb bed make after 4~June in, into Sexual propagation, vegetative propagation or the mass reproduc of row Rhizoma Gastrodiae.The vegetative propagation of Rhizoma Gastrodiae above-mentioned, specially:Select not damaged, nothing It rots, the kind in 1 generation of breeding or 2 generations that growth cone is full fiber crops;Numb bed upper layer of soil is removed, the upper part of bacterium material is made to expose native face, Bacterium material is chopped to fish scale mouth every 10~15cm;At bacterium material fish scale mouth and the every 5~10cm of gap of bacterium material, a kind of fiber crops are put, The Armillaria mellea of one piece of 2cm square is put at fish scale mouth, the kind fiber crops tail portion at fish scale mouth abuts Armillaria mellea;With small Gap between the new bacterium material filling kind fiber crops of block, spreads the broken blade of broad leaf tree of 1~3mm of a layer thickness, and cladding thickness about 10cm's is fresh thin Soil.The sexual propagation of Rhizoma Gastrodiae above-mentioned, specially:Numb bed upper layer of soil is removed, the broad leaf tree for broadcasting sowing 1~3mm of a layer thickness is broken Blade;The new bacterium material of one layer of fritter of laid parallel, spacing about 5cm;Uniform broadcasting is mixed with the Germination Strain of seeds of Gastrodia elata between gap;It broadcasts sowing The broken blade of the broad leaf tree of 1~3mm of a layer thickness, the fresh fine earth of cladding thickness about 10cm.The mixed planting of Rhizoma Gastrodiae above-mentioned, tool Body is:In aforementioned vegetative propagation, behind gap between the new bacterium material filling kind fiber crops of fritter, uniform broadcasting is mixed with the sprouting of seeds of Gastrodia elata Bacterium;Broadcast sowing the broken blade of broad leaf tree of 1~3mm of a layer thickness, the fresh fine earth of cladding thickness about 10cm.
It is harvested according to the growth characteristics of implantation time and Rhizoma Gastrodiae, umbellate pore furgus, concrete operations are:(1) Rhizoma Gastrodiae vegetative propagation, Current year or next year harvesting arrow fiber crops, remove the soil of lower part in numb bed, the bacterium material not run out of, which is taken advantage of a situation, to be moved down, and a layer thickness 1 is broadcasted sowing The broken blade of the broad leaf tree of~3mm, the fresh fine earth of cladding thickness about 10cm.Carry out field management, next year or third year harvesting at Ripe umbellate pore furgus broadcasts sowing the broken blade of broad leaf tree of 1~3mm of a layer thickness, the fresh fine earth of cladding thickness about 10cm.Carry out field pipe Reason is all harvested to umbellate pore furgus maturation.(2) gastrodia elata sexual propagation harvests hemp in current year or next year, according to bacterium material Expenditure Levels And halimasch growing state, appropriate to add the new bacterium material of fritter, Armillaria mellea, the broad leaf tree for broadcasting sowing a layer thickness about 1~3mm is broken Blade, the fresh fine earth of cladding thickness 10cm;Next year or third year harvesting arrow fiber crops, remove numb bed underlying soil, harvest maturation Umbellate pore furgus, while the bacterium material that Rhizoma Gastrodiae does not run out of being displaced downwardly to around immature umbellate pore furgus, broadcast sowing the broad-leaved of 1~3mm of a layer thickness Set broken blade, the fresh fine earth of cladding thickness about 8cm;Field management is carried out, after umbellate pore furgus is mature, is all harvested.(3) Rhizoma Gastrodiae is mixed Plantation is closed, is added in right amount small in current year or next year harvesting arrow fiber crops or hemp according to bacterium material Expenditure Levels and halimasch growing state The new bacterium material of block, Armillaria mellea, broadcast sowing the broken blade of broad leaf tree of 1~3mm of a layer thickness, and cladding thickness about 10cm's is fresh thin Soil;Next year or third year harvesting commodity fiber crops, remove numb bed underlying soil, harvest mature umbellate pore furgus, while Rhizoma Gastrodiae not being run out of Bacterium material be displaced downwardly to around immature umbellate pore furgus, broadcast sowing the broken blade of broad leaf tree of 1~3mm of a layer thickness, cladding thickness about 8cm's Fresh fine earth;Field management is carried out, to umbellate pore furgus maturation, is all harvested.
Above-mentioned kind winter sweet-smelling grass is poured with 2%~5% limewash and is spilt, carried out disinfection after umbellate pore furgus all harvesting, and about 48 After hour, the bacterium material not run out of is taken out;Bacterium bed is flattened, the bacterium material that does not run out of of tiling 8~10cm of thickness, every 3~ 5cm puts the winter sweet-smelling grass strain of one piece of 3cm square;The leaf of bamboo of 1~3mm of uniform fold thickness is put 10~15cm of thickness and is not consumed Complete bacterium material is poured with the white sugar water of concentration about 2%~5% and is spilt, the leaf of bamboo of 2~5mm of uniform fold a layer thickness;Field management, It is harvested after winter sweet-smelling grass is mature, can continuously harvest for 2 seasons.After first season harvesting, according to the Expenditure Levels of bacterium material, fritter can be added in right amount New bacterium material.
A kind of preferred ecologic planting Rhizoma Gastrodiae, umbellate pore furgus, winter sweet-smelling grass method, the continuous winter sweet-smelling grass for harvesting aforementioned kind of 2 seasons, bacterium Material is depleted substantially, and bacterium bed is cleaned out;Repeat same cave interplanting Rhizoma Gastrodiae, umbellate pore furgus, kind winter sweet-smelling grass.
The method for selecting ecologic planting Rhizoma Gastrodiae provided by the invention, umbellate pore furgus, winter sweet-smelling grass, occurs after solving continuous planting rhizoma gastrodiae Yield decline, quality deterioration, and require selection is new to open up wasteland or the problem of planting rhizoma gastrodiae is carried out in idle 5 years or more plot.It is raw State plant this method follow given birth to state, the ecological economics rule, according to Rhizoma Gastrodiae, umbellate pore furgus, winter sweet-smelling grass growth-development law, use Between traditional agriculture, the planting patterns such as set combined with modern agriculture science and technology, by same cave interplanting umbellate pore furgus, and in interval Interior plantation winter sweet-smelling grass can both improve physicochemical properties and the bioactivity such as soil hardening after planting rhizoma gastrodiae, stickiness weight, ventilative difference, also Bacterium material is made full use of, makes kind of the fast quick-recovery of ground ecology, reduces miscellaneous bacteria caused by continuous cropping and endanger, eliminate halimasch to the " anti-of Rhizoma Gastrodiae The generation of digestion " phenomenon solves Rhizoma Gastrodiae continuous cropping obstacle, while the umbellate pore furgus that can also get bumper crops, winter sweet-smelling grass.Due to not using pesticide, chemical fertilizer, kind Ground ecological environment is much improved, and improves the utilization rate in soil, the recycling rate of bacterium material, obtains production development, energy The mutually unified comprehensive effects such as source recycling, ecological environmental protection, economic benefit make Rhizoma Gastrodiae, umbellate pore furgus, the production of winter sweet-smelling grass in good Property circulation in.Reach has output every year, and there is the beneficial effect of income in peasant household every year, greatly improves Cotton Varieties by Small Farming Households enthusiasm, also for The popularization of ecologic planting mode provides practical advice.

Specific embodiment
The following examples are used to illustrate the present invention, but are not intended to limit the scope of the present invention..
Embodiment 1
1) material prepares
A. the blade of broad leaf tree is smashed, size is 1~4cm2;New big ferfas material, small ferfas material, are inoculated with halimasch Original bacterium material;Kind fiber crops, umbellate pore furgus strain, winter sweet-smelling grass strain, Armillaria mellea.
B. it has left unused 5 years to kind, has carried out plantation work January.
2) step
A. the production of the plantation of umbellate pore furgus and numb bed
After fixed bacterium bed, is poured and spilt with 2%~5% limewash;After about 48 hours, the broad leaf tree of a layer thickness about 1mm is spread Broken blade is rebasing, and the new bacterium material of bulk is replaced with the bacterium material of inoculation halimasch and is put, bacterium material is about spaced 2cm;Halimasch will be inoculated with Bacterium material be chopped to fish scale mouth every about 15cm, the umbellate pore furgus strain and Armillaria mellea of one piece of 2cm square are put at fish scale mouth, Gap is tamped with the new bacterium material of fritter or fine earth, cladding thickness about 2cm fine earth, the new bacterium material of 1 layer of bulk of parallel laid, bacterium material interval is about 2cm, puts the Armillaria mellea of 2cm square, strain interval 15cm in interval, and the new bacterium material of fritter or fine earth tamp gap, spread The broken blade of a layer thickness about 1mm broad leaf tree is broadcast, cladding thickness 8cm fine earth is to get numb bed.
B. the plantation of Rhizoma Gastrodiae
April vegetative propagation current year is carried out, is selected not damaged, numb without the 1 generation kind rotted, growth cone is full;It removes on numb bed Layer soil makes partially to expose native face on bacterium material, bacterium material is chopped to fish scale mouth every 15cm;At bacterium material fish scale mouth and bacterium material gap At about 8cm, a kind of fiber crops are put, the Armillaria mellea of one piece of 2cm square is put at fish scale mouth, make the kind at fish scale mouth Numb tail portion abuts Armillaria mellea;Gap between the new bacterium material filling kind fiber crops of fritter, spreads the broken blade of broad leaf tree of a layer thickness about 1mm, The fresh fine earth of cladding thickness about 10cm.
C. the harvesting of Rhizoma Gastrodiae, umbellate pore furgus
It harvests arrow fiber crops March next year, removes the soil of lower part in numb bed, the bacterium material not run out of, which is taken advantage of a situation, to be moved down, and broadcasts sowing one layer The broken blade of broad leaf tree of thickness about 1mm, the fresh fine earth of cladding thickness about 10cm;Carry out field management, April in third year harvesting at After ripe umbellate pore furgus, the broken blade of broad leaf tree of a layer thickness about 1mm, the fresh fine earth of cladding thickness about 10cm are broadcasted sowing;Carry out field Management, in May, the 4th, umbellate pore furgus is mature, all harvests.
D. winter sweet-smelling grass is planted between
Umbellate pore furgus all after harvesting, is poured with 2% limewash and spills bacterium bed, and after about 48 hours, the bacterium material not run out of is taken out; Bacterium bed is flattened, the bacterium material that tiling thickness about 8mm does not run out of puts the winter sweet-smelling grass strain of one piece of 3cm square every 4cm;It broadcasts sowing The leaf of bamboo of a layer thickness about 2mm, the bacterium material that cladding thickness about 10cm does not run out of are poured with the white sugar water of concentration about 3% and are spilt, bacterium bed The blade of uniform fold a layer thickness about 3cm;Field management can add the new bacterium material of fritter according to the Expenditure Levels of bacterium material in right amount, In March, the 5th, the harvesting of winter sweet-smelling grass maturation, in December, the 5th carry out second of winter sweet-smelling grass harvesting.
E. bacterium bed is cleaned out, repeats same cave according to abovementioned steps a~d in December, the 5th and interplants Rhizoma Gastrodiae, umbellate pore furgus, Between plant winter sweet-smelling grass.
From Rhizoma Gastrodiae, umbellate pore furgus, winter sweet-smelling grass growing state from the point of view of, second kind plant with for the first time plantation growing way it is good, grow Neatly, Process of Armillaria Mellea Infection rate is high.In terms of yield, second kind is planted, no significant difference little with the output fluctuation of first time plantation: One mu by plantation 40 square metres in terms of, every square metre of harvesting arrow fiber crops are 4 kilograms, i.e. 160 kilograms of per mu yield;Every square metre of third year adopts About 2 kilograms of umbellate pore furgus are received, i.e. 80 kilograms of per mu yield;4th year about 4 kilograms of every square metre of harvesting umbellate pore furgus, i.e. 160 kilograms of per mu yield;5th year Harvesting winter sweet-smelling grass for the first time, about 3 kilograms every square metre, i.e. per mu yield 120 kg;5th year second harvesting winter sweet-smelling grass, every square metre about 5 Kilogram, i.e. 200 kilograms of per mu yield.
